How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Evanston?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Evanston Studio Apartments | $1,463 | $700 | $3,358 |
Evanston 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,943 | $945 | $4,880 |
Evanston 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,738 | $1,500 | $6,778 |
Evanston 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,083 | $1,595 | $7,694 |
Evanston 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,162 | $2,550 | $10,000+ |
Evanston 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,311 | $3,000 | $7,035 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Evanston
How much are Studio apartments in Evanston?
There are currently 835 Studio Apartments in Evanston with rent ranges from $700 to $3,358 with an average price of $1,463.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Evanston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Evanston ranges from $945 to $4,880 with an average monthly rent of $1,943.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Evanston c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Evanston range from $1,500 to $6,778.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,738.
How expensive are Evanston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 429 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Evanston on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,595 to $7,694 - averaging $3,083 for the location.
